RB Isaiah Pead plans on playing catch-up this week after missing the first two weeks of OTAs because of the NFL’s rule that prohibits rookies from attending offseason activities until their school’s senior class has graduated. Pead has been spending extra time with RBs coach Ben Sirmans after practice and will also spend his off days at Rams Park.
